Technical Writer

At PAE, we support some of New Zealand’s most important infrastructure including our long standing relationship with the New Zealand Defence Force. We’re a national facilities management provider, known for being practical, responsive, and focused on keeping our customers’ worlds working and moving.

We’re currently delivering a significant transition programme across multiple NZDF sites. With new contracts and changes in delivery, there’s a real need to capture how work is done and make sure that knowledge is clear, consistent, and easy for teams to pick up from day one.

That’s where this role comes in.

We’re looking for someone who can take how things actually work on the ground and turn it into clear, practical documentation that others can follow. You’ll work closely with operational leaders and site teams to understand processes, make sense of different approaches, and turn that into structured, usable documentation. Along the way, you’ll identify gaps, inconsistencies or risks and help tidy those up.

What you’ll be doing:

  • Developing SOPs, manuals, work instructions and other key operational documents
  • Working directly with subject matter experts to capture and validate information
  • Turning complex or inconsistent processes into something clear and practical
  • Identifying gaps, duplication, or risks in existing documentation
  • Supporting site transitions so teams can hit the ground running
  • Applying consistent document control and quality standards

What we’re looking for:

  • Experience in technical writing, documentation, or a similar role
  • Strong ability to simplify complex information without losing meaning
  • Confidence working with a wide range of stakeholders
  • Good organisation and the ability to manage competing priorities
  • A practical mindset someone who focuses on what will actually work on the ground
  • A class 1 Licence and the ability to travel to our operational sites around New Zealand

Experience in operational, facilities, engineering or service environments would be helpful, but not essential.

This is a fixed term role through to November 2026 and a chance to be involved in something that has real impact across multiple sites.
